Schools in Egypt Admission Process

 

  • First select a select a school for admission
  • Parents must visit the official website of the school.
  • Upon visiting the official website of the school a parent should complete the online registration.
  • Completing the above process the parent now will personally visit the school and complete the further process of documents submission and other formalities.
  • Some schools may take an entrance exam or a personal interview for the purpose of selection.
  • School authorities after selecting the child offer a selection letter.
  • Make sure to deposit the school fee to confirm your child admission.

 

Essential Documents Required for Admission in Schools in Egypt

 

  • A copy of the pupil’s latest Academic Report Cards from the last two years (if transferring here).
  • Original Birth Certificates (locals)
  • A Copy of Foreign Birth Certificate
  • passport size photos
  • Copy of the child’s and parents’ IDs and Passports
  • Copy Expatriates Registration from the previous school (transferring students)
  • Letter of approval from the embassy directed to MCE (for transfer students)
  • Behaviour Reference letter stamped by the previous school (for transferring students)
  • Transfer letter certified and stamped by the student’s previous school and the Educational Directorate (for transfer students)
